    Bloodstream Infections and Frequency of Pretreatment Associated With Age and Hospitalization Status in Sub-Saharan Africa. 

    Aaby, P; Ahmed El Tayeb, M; Ali, M; Aseffa, A; Baker, S; Bjerregaard-Andersen, M; Breiman, RF; ... (45 authors) (Clin Infect Dis, 2015-11-01)
    BACKGROUND: The clinical diagnosis of bacterial bloodstream infections (BSIs) in sub-Saharan Africa is routinely confused with malaria due to overlapping symptoms. The Typhoid Surveillance in Africa Program (TSAP) recruited ...
